One of the most empirically validated intraday setups — with a direct peer-reviewed test behind it.
Supporting
- Holmberg, Lönnbark & Lundström (2013) tested opening-range-breakout strategies directly and found returns significantly above a fair game.
- Toby Crabel (1990) documented the opening-range edge in a large OHLC study.
⚠️ Caveats — things to watch for
- Transaction costs can erode the edge — keep costs low.
- Pair it with a Range-vs-Trend filter and volume confirmation.

Volume is U-shaped across the session — the open is one of the two busiest, most volatile windows, so the levels set early carry real weight. The 10:00 mark isn't magic; the edge lives in the range itself, confirmed by internals ($TICK / TRIN / A-D). Classify the day Range-vs-Trend, then let that classification govern how you trade it.
Practical takeaway: trade the breakout only when the range is resolved and internals agree; demand ≥3 confluence factors; and size for the day's true range. The setup is strong — the discipline around it is what makes it pay.
